> This extends the setup_tc framework so it can support more than just
> the mqprio offload and push other classifiers and qdiscs into the
> hardware. The series here targets the u32 classifier and ixgbe
> driver. I worked out the u32 classifier because it is protocol
> oblivious and aligns with multiple hardware devices I have access
> to. I did an initial implementation on ixgbe because (a) I have one
> in my box (b) its a stable driver and (c) it is relatively simple
> compared to the other devices I have here but still has enough
> flexibility to exercise the features of cls_u32.
> 
> I intentionally limited the scope of this series to the basic
> feature set. Specifically this uses a 'big hammer' feature bit
> to do the offload or not. If the bit is set you get offloaded rules
> if it is not then rules will not be offloaded. If we can agree on
> this patch series there are some more patches on my queue we can
> talk about to make the offload decision per rule using flags similar
> to how we do l2 mac updates. Additionally the error strategy can
> be improved to be hard aborting, log and continue, etc. I think
> these are nice to have improvements but shouldn't block this series.
> 
> Also by adding get_parse_graph and set_parse_graph attributes as
> in my previous flow_api work we can build programmable devices
> and programmatically learn when rules can or can not be loaded
> into the hardware. Again future work.
